BAFEST 2018: When Tiwa Savage, Awilo Logomba, Kizz Daniel Shut Down Eko AtlanticThe Born in Africa Festival (BAFEST) was held in style at Eko Atlantic last weekend bringing some the biggest entertainers in the country including Burna Boy, Kizz Daniel, D’Banj and Tiwa Savage, as well continental stars Awilo Logomba and Sho Madjozi as Tiger Beer and Livespot partnered with Livespot at the inaugural edition of the […]
